News

A staggering 16 billion user logins have reportedly been leaked online in what cybersecurity experts are calling a “digital tsunami.” ...
Wondering if your information is posted online from a data breach? Here's how to check if your accounts are at risk and what ...
Researchers discovered a leak of 16 billion stolen passwords involving platforms like Apple, Gmail, and Facebook. Learn how ...